[发明专利]以物换物过程中的匹配方法和系统在审
申请号: | 201610402231.4 | 申请日: | 2016-06-08 |
公开(公告)号: | CN107481077A | 公开(公告)日: | 2017-12-15 |
发明(设计)人: | 钟颖 | 申请(专利权)人: | 北京京东尚科信息技术有限公司;北京京东世纪贸易有限公司 |
主分类号: | G06Q30/06 | 分类号: | G06Q30/06 |
代理公司: | 中原信达知识产权代理有限责任公司11219 | 代理人: | 张一军,赵静 |
地址: | 100195 北京市海淀区杏石口路6*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 物换物 过程 中的 匹配 方法 系统 | ||
技术领域
本发明涉及计算机技术和软件领域,尤其涉及一种以物换物过程中的匹配方法和系统。
背景技术
以物换物,顾名思义,就是指用自己已有的物品或服务与别人交换,以换取别人的物品或服务。
在以物换物的交易中,通常是交易双方进行面对面的线下交易,或者是交易发起方以其可交换物品在线上发贴以寻求用户。通过交易双方提出自己可供交换的物品,由双方协商同意后完成物品的交换。
上述以物换物的交易方式存在一定的局限性,即交易通常只在两者之间发生,交易物品的相互匹配的概率相对较低,匹配的效率相对缓慢。当用户自己所拥有的物品并不能满足目标物品属主的需求时,往往无法直接达成交易,因此寻求一种高效的以物换物的过程中交易物品的匹配机制是亟待解决的问题。
发明内容
有鉴于此,本发明提供一种以物换物过程中的匹配方法和系统,能够提高可供交易物品匹配的机率和效率。
为实现上述目的,根据本发明的一个方面,提供了一种以物换物过程中的匹配方法。
本发明的一种以物换物过程中的匹配方法包括:获取并保存各用 户可供交换物品的信息和目标物品的信息;获取用户A的匹配请求,并根据所述匹配请求在多个用户之中进行匹配,其中所述匹配请求包括用户A的可供交换物品和本次匹配的目标物品;输出匹配链,其中,根据所述匹配请求在多个用户之中进行匹配包括:步骤一:获取本次匹配的目标物品的属主用户B的目标物品的集合C;步骤二:在所述用户A的可供交换物品组成的集合D中查询是否存在与所述集合C中的物品匹配的物品,若存在则完成匹配;否则,步骤三:查询集合D的子可交换物品集合D1,并记录集合D1中物品的父可交换物品的ID,在所述集合D1中查询是否存在与所述集合C中的物品匹配的物品,若存在则完成匹配,所述集合D的子可交换物品集合D1是指其他用户的以所述集合D中的物品为目标物品的物品的集合,所述集合D1中物品的父可交换物品是指存在于集合D中的、集合D1中物品的目标物品;否则,步骤四:以所述集合D1为新的集合D,重复步骤三,直至涉及匹配的用户人数超过预设阈值;上述步骤一至步骤四中的集合是以数组的形式呈现,数组中的元素为以物品名称为键,物品ID为值的键值对。
可选地,所述方法还包括:涉及匹配的用户人数小于等于5。
可选地,所述方法还包括:以分库分表的形式存储各用户可供交换物品的信息和目标物品的信息,所述可供交换物品的信息和目标物品的信息包括各物品的ID、名称、分类、照片、使用年限及其他自定义信息。
可选地,输出匹配链还包括:根据集合D1中匹配成功的物品的父可交换物品的ID,查询所述父可交换物品的父可交换物品,并重复此步骤,直至回溯到最初的交换物品集合D,以输出在多个用户之中完成匹配的匹配链。
可选地,所述匹配链中包括:整体匹配方案、用户信息、物品信 息。
为实现上述目的,根据本发明的另一方面,提供了一种以物换物过程中的匹配系统。
本发明的一种以物换物过程中的匹配系统包括:物品模块,用于获取并保存各用户可供交换物品的信息和目标物品的信息;匹配模块,用于获取用户A的匹配请求,并根据所述匹配请求在多个用户之中进行匹配,其中所述匹配请求包括用户A的可供交换物品和本次匹配的目标物品;输出模块,用于输出匹配链,其中,其中,所述匹配模块还用于:步骤一:获取本次匹配的目标物品的属主用户B的目标物品的集合C;步骤二:在所述用户A的可供交换物品组成的集合D中查询是否存在与所述集合C中的物品匹配的物品,若存在则完成匹配;否则,步骤三:查询集合D的子可交换物品集合D1,并记录集合D1中物品的父可交换物品的ID,在所述集合D1中查询是否存在与所述集合C中的物品匹配的物品,若存在则完成匹配,所述集合D的子可交换物品集合D1是指其他用户的以所述集合D中的物品为目标物品的物品的集合,所述集合D1中物品的父可交换物品是指存在于集合D中的、集合D1中物品的目标物品;否则,步骤四:以所述集合D1为新的集合D,重复步骤三,直至涉及匹配的用户人数超过预设阈值;上述步骤一至步骤四中的集合是以数组的形式呈现,数组中的元素为以物品名称为键,物品ID为值的键值对。
可选地,所述匹配模块中,涉及匹配的用户人数小于等于5。
可选地,所述物品模块还用于:以分库分表的形式存储各用户可供交换物品的信息和目标物品的信息,所述可供交换物品的信息和目标物品的信息包括各物品的ID、名称、分类、照片、使用年限及其他自定义信息。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京京东尚科信息技术有限公司;北京京东世纪贸易有限公司,未经北京京东尚科信息技术有限公司;北京京东世纪贸易有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201610402231.4/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种同时支持多个平台轻便式管理系统
- 下一篇:私家车联网出租方法和系统